Naval Surface Warfare Center (NSWC) Crane has a requirement for engineering and logistics support services to conduct engineering analysis to evaluate the current P-8A Turret Deployment Drive System (TDDS) against the new estimated Navy Tactical Airborne Sensor (TAS) loads.
The proposed contract action is for the supplies for which the Government intends to solicit and negotiate with one source, Hoffman Engineering. under the authority of FAR 13.101(b).
All responsible sources may submit a capability statement, which shall be considered by the agency.
However, a determination by the Government not to compete with this proposed contract based upon responses to this solicitation is solely within the discretion of the Government.
Information received will normally be considered solely for the purpose of determining whether to conduct a competitive procurement.

How to bid on this
This is a contract solicitation, not a grant. To bid, you submit a proposal (usually a price and a description of how you would do the work) directly to the government, through the channel the official listing specifies, not through Oppward.
- Make sure your business has an active SAM.gov registration. You cannot be paid on a federal contract without one.
- Read the full solicitation on the official listing above, especially the scope of work, not just this summary. Our guide to reading a solicitation walks through what to look for.
- Check the set-aside listed above and confirm your business actually qualifies for it before you spend time on a proposal. See our guide to set-asides if the category is unfamiliar.
- Submit your proposal by the deadline, using the exact submission method the official listing states. A technically on-time bid sent the wrong way is often treated as late.
